9-8-08  Northwood at Clarksburg

                Northwood wins in 3 games   25-22, 25-12, 25-21    

    Current Record  1-0

We started the season off on the road again at Clarksburg.  The Coyotes had made drastic improvements in their all-around team.  We were unsure of what we had given that we graduated 5 seniors.  The scores went back and forth in the first game until the end when we took control and grabbed a 25-22 victory.  The win put Clarksburg on their heels a little bit and led us to a commanding 25-12 win in the second game.  But then we let up a little bit and did not focus as much, but we were able to pull it out at the end again and complete a 3 game sweep with a 25-21 win in the third game.  All-in-all it was a good start to the season.  Looks like we’re headed in the right direction and could come close to where our team record was from last year.

 

9-11-08  Wheaton @ Northwood

                Northwood wins in 3 games  25-10, 25-9, 25-10        

   Current Record  2-0

We came into the game against Wheaton expecting to win very easily given how their team has been in the past few seasons.  However, they have a new coach and a new attitude and they were ready for the challenge.  I was a little surprised to start off the game and the girls were a little sluggish at the beginning, again reacting instead of playing and predicting.  But we figured things out quickly and ran out three games where we were able to frustrate Wheaton and get them back on their heels.  The final scores were 25-10, 25-9, 25-10.  A good victory for us that put us at 2-0 on the season!

 

9-15-08  Northwest @ Northwood

                Northwood loses in 4 games  12-25, 14-25, 25-22, 21-25  

   Current Record  2-1

We played about even with Northwest last year and that was my expectation for this season as well.  Northwest had a few girls that went to camps and played over the summer and along with adding a very impressive  freshmen to their squad they came out firing from the start.  We couldn’t block anything that they hit at us so we were having some serious defensive issues  and forever scrambling to pass the ball up.  We lost the first two games quickly (12-25, 14-25) and we really didn’t have any emotion on our side.  The third game something clicked and we were able to play with them and win points that we couldn’t earlier in the match, it was close but we beat them 25-22 in the third.  We were back and forth in the 4th game, went down by 7, brought it back and tied it up then a bad call went against us and we lost our focus.  Northwest went on to win25-21 in the fifth, but the girls weren’t upset how it ended, more so how things went in the first couple of games.

 

9-17-08  Northwood @ Springbrook

                Northwood loses in 5 games  19-25, 25-19, 26-24, 24-26, 5-15

                Current Record  2-2

We had an unbelievable 5 game match against Springbrook last season and this one…exactly the same!  Unfortunately it had the same result in that we didn’t win, I even tried to bargain with the Springbrook coach before the 5th game started and told it that it was only fair that we win, but apparently she didn’t get the message!  The match couldn’t have been more even, they won the first game 25-19, we won the 2nd game 25-19.  We won the 3rd game 26-24, they won the 4th game 26-24.  So you’d think close in the fifth?  I wish it was, but we had some serving issues and got behind early and could never dig out (no pun intended).  It was a tough loss to swallow, but again the girls understand how well they are playing and how close they are to being a “winning team”.  Serving remains an issue and we’ll continue to work on it during practice.

 

9-23-08  Blair @ Northwood  “Battle of the Boulevard”

                Northwood loses in 5 games  12-25, 17-25, 25-18, 25-22, 15-17

                Current Record  2-3

Before today Northwood had never won a game within a match against Blair in either the Boys or Girls season.  The streak is over!  Unfortunately not totally over because we couldn’t pull off the win, but I’d have to say it’s the best loss I’ve ever had!  Not much took place in the first two games and the faces on the girls and faces in the crowd showed that.  Not a lot of talking and not a lot of movement.  But just as in other matches we started to come alive and “POW” right back in the match as we won the 3rd and 4th game!  The 5th game was back and forth and back and forth and back and…you get the point.  The game is only played to 15 points and the teams were tied at 13-13…you have to win by two in order to finish and we went up 14-13 and had it in our grasp, but the ball did not want to bounce in our direction and unfortunately they pulled it out 17-15.  The emotion in the gym and the way the last couple of games went was almost surreal.  Our girls played so well and we had Blair on the heels and very frustrated at times.  Even though we lost, there wasn’t a single person on our side that was upset, everyone was pumped that we were even in that position to give ourselves a chance.  We all know that it really wasn’t a loss, even though it said so in the official scorebook, but none of us care about that.  This match should really help us as we move into the middle part of the season where we have some games that will be on the same level as this one.  I’m not doing justice writing up this match I’m sure, but it was an unbelievable evening that I will never forget.

9-26-08   Northwood @ Walter Johnson

                Northwood loses in 4 games  22-25, 22-25, 25-19, 15-25

                Current Record  2-4

We were very evenly matched with the Lady Wildcats in this game.  Points went back and forth, but our serving let us down again.  We were able to win points at all times, but we continually gave the ball back with serving errors on first and second serves.  We could have won in 3 games if we had some more serves in, but we were unable to overcome our own mistakes.  We did get it together in the 3rd game and took it 25-19.  However, we ran out of gas and out of plays in the 4th game and Walter Johnson did not.  Their consistency led to a nice victory for them.  We will continue to work on serving and movement on the court during all plays.

 

10-2-08  Northwood @ Richard Montgomery

                Northwood wins in 3 games   25-15, 25-16, 25-13

                Current Record  3-4

A commanding victory for the Northwood girls!  We were able to limit our mistakes and get our serves in on a consistent basis.  We were able to get R.M. in a big hole to start off the first game and we never looked back.   With strong play from all the seniors, (Kathy, Lizzie and Maggie) we were able to score points easily at times and still able to score them when the ball was going back and forth.  Our movement on the court during  plays was the best I had ever seen.  We hope to keep that going for the rest of the season, except make it even better.  This was by far the best win we’ve had this season and our confidence level has risen.  This will hopefully lead us to getting our record back to .500 next week and then we can move on from there.

 

10-7-08   Northwood  vs. Einstein

                Northwood wins in 3 games   25-21, 25-16, 25-15

                Current Record   4-4

We came into this game with a lot of confidence.  We’ve been starting to play well and it was showing in the girls attitudes during games and especially during practices.  Unfortunately, we came in a little over-confident and did not realize how much Einstein had improved.  They’ve  done a nice job building their program back up there as well.  I’m very happy about the level of volleyball in the DCC this year, all of the teams are competitive and I believe it is due to the coaches that have stayed in or the new coaches that have come aboard.  They are all working hard to gain respect for their respective schools and it is showing in all the matches they are playing. 

We were able to overcome an early 5 point deficit in the first game and rally to win 25-21.  We started moving better and we were then ready for the ball to continue returning to us on plays that normally we’d see the ball hit the floor!  Once we got moving we were able to frustrate the Einstein girls a little bit and we were able to get off our heels and go at them.  We pulled out two more wins and beat the Titans in 3 straight games.  That’s two matches in a row where we’ve won in 3 straight and that gives us a lot of momentum going into a tough match against a perennial volleyball power in Churchill.  We’re going to play them in a “Dig Pink” game to help raise awareness and money for Breast Cancer Research on Friday.  The girls are excited about practicing to get ready to play them, so hopefully we’ll continue to make some progress.

 

10-10-08  @ Churchill

                Northwood loses in 4 games  16-25, 24-26, 25-19, 18-25

                Current Record  4-5

Tonight we helped Churchill in their efforts to raise money for Breast Cancer Research and Awareness in their “Dig Pink” game.  It was a huge success and a great atmosphere to play a game in.  It’s  the first time in my 9 years of coaching that I’ve had the cheerleaders, the step team and the drumline at a volleyball game!  It was an intense matchup, back and forth the whole time.  We let up near the end of the first game and Churchill went on a small run to finish the game off.  We had a shot at the second game, but unfortunately let it slip away at the end.  We played very well in the next game as well and took it easily 25-19.  But in the end, we ran out of gas and out of plays and Churchill was able to put it away 25-18.  It was a tough loss, but we played well against a strong team again so we cannot hang our heads. 

 

10-13-08  vs. Whitman

                Northwood loses in 5 games  25-18, 25-18, 23-25, 14-25, 11-15

                Current Record 4-6

What a match!  We were cruising, playing very well after the first 2 ½ games, then something went wrong.  We were up 14-6 in the third game and all of a sudden our passing went out the window.  We couldn’t get anything up and we struggled to get free balls over the net. Whitman came all the way back and then we started to play again, but it was too late, we lost 23-25.  The 4th game, nothing went right, and I couldn’t come up with any answers.  We were able to re-group in the 5th game after being down 9-4, we brought it back and went up 11-9.  After a Whitman timeout, we couldn’t hold it and they went on another 6 point streak to finish the game and the match.  It was an extremely unfortunate loss for us given that we played so well at the beginning and we had a big lead.  I think it’s partly because we’ve never been in that situation before of being in control and then having to hold on to put a team away.  It’s our 3rd 5 game loss this season!  The girls know that 4-6 really could be 7-3 or even higher given a bounce of the ball here or there in a different direction.  We’re frustrated but still understand that we have the ability to play well and play well against good teams.  We’re looking forward to our next matchup on Wednesday against Kennedy where we’ll try again to get our 5th win.
